Abstract
Flue-cured tobacco horizontal hot air furnace combustion fan heat-insulating protective device, including straight tube, bend pipe, electromagnet, spring and irony baffle plate, bend pipe import is tightly connected the air outflow port opened up on straight tube inducer tube wall, bend pipe air outlet slit end and straight tube air outlet slit end are non-intersect, straight tube central axis and bend pipe center line are on same perpendicular, baffle plate and spring connection, spring and electromagnet connection, baffle plate are moved up and down in straight tube groove.Electromagnet power supply line access controller original combustion fan power supply wiring hole.Baffle plate minimum point is pulled to straight tube inner chamber extreme higher position when electromagnet is powered, and blower fan air blast flows through straight tube and serves as combustion air, and baffle plate minimum point is fallen after rise to groove extreme lower position during power-off, and air blast flows through bend pipe formation cooling air curtain protection baffle plate and blower fan.Interruption supplies a small amount of combustion air to control the intensive flue-cured tobacco continuous tunnel furnace burnt in stove that the utility model can be used.Utility model combustion fan is stable, without temperature rise, being leaked without high temperature gas flow causes to burn fan trouble.

Background technology
Continuous tunnel furnace is because with disposably coalingging, need not see the advantages such as fiery stoking, obtain more next in dense tobacco flue-curing house halfway
More popularization and application.The a small amount of combustion air of continuous tunnel furnace interruption supply, maintains furnace temperature needed for tobacco flue-curing.1100~1300 in stove
DEG C high temperature combustion zone is only separated by close to combustion fan, high-temperature region and blower fan air outlet with cast iron fire door, and fan coil is vulnerable to logical
Cross the high temperature heat radiation effect that fire door air inlet leaks.Combustion fan not air feed, chimney breast strong wind pour in down a chimney, furnace gas flowing by
Easily there is pressure-fired and the unordered play phenomenon of flare in stove when being not suitable in resistance and flue damper fiery Board position, and can substantially observe and pass through
High temperature gas flow or high temperature flare that fire door air inlet outwards sprays.High temperature gas flow directly heats blower fan by fan outlet first
Impeller casing, then impeller and casing high temperature is transferred to by motor coil by electric machine main shaft, finally occur under off working state
Burn-down of electric motor failure.Investigation display, continuous tunnel furnace combustion fan high temperature damage rate is up to 39%.Motor coil temperature is raised, blower fan
Draft capacity declines, and this blower fan draft capacity, which declines failure, can not often repair recovery, can only update replacement, be brought to tobacco grower
Economic loss.Flavescence fixation stage combustion fan, which burns, causes baking temperature to decline problem, is difficult to be found for a long time, often occurs
Whole room quality of tobacco, which declines, even all scraps phenomenon, and bigger economic loss is brought to tobacco grower.Combustion fan is solved by heat waste
Problem is ruined, is continuous tunnel furnace popularization and application problem urgently to be resolved hurrily.
